PostgreSQL

Zdravim,

vo verejnej sprave (VS) je tazke presvedcit ludi o tom, ze OSS moze byt adekvatna nahrada komercneho produktu. Nie som zaryty zastupca OSS, skor sa na to pozeram tak, ze treba hladat vhodnu technologiu na zaklade poziadaviek…

Myslim si, ze vhodnym dialogom a hlavne poukazanim na niektore technologie sa vie tato problematika lepsie priblizit statu. Idealne je vsetko jasne demonstrovat a ukazat, kde sa co pouzilo a ze to zije, bezi a pod.

Napriklad pri debate o DB - PostgreSQL vs. ORACLE, som sa stretol s takymito tvrdeniami, argumentmi, ktore su prezentovane ludom na strane statu a hlavne netechnickym ludom:

  • ORACLE je ako mercedes, BMW medzi DB a ma teda lepsi servis, vykon,
  • pri PostgreSQL nie je zaruka, ze ten produkt prezije a ze bude k nemu servis/support,
  • ORACLE je overene tisickami instalacii a pod.,
  • pri miliardach zaznamov je PostgreSQL pomala a pod.,
  • nasadenim PostgreSQL sa hazarduje s celym riesenim a skolabuje a pod.

Moje skusenosti s VS su take, ze ludia akceptuju najma postupy, veci, riesenia, ktore uz boli pouzite niekde inde a funguju. Je malo ludi (podla mna), ktori su ochotni riskovat, zmenit zauzivane veci, skusit nieco “nove” a pod.

Preto si myslim, ze by bolo fajn pozbierat co najviac argumentov, benchmarkov, ukazat konkretne projekty, kde su pouzite alternativne technologie, popisat vykonove parametre a pod., aby sa tieto info mohli lahko sirit medzi ludmi.

Ako s prvou genericky pouzitelnou technologiou navrhujem zacat s DB PostgreSQL.

Cize bolo by super, keby ste vedeli zdielat info typu a z tychto oblasti:

  • idenitifikaciu projektov v SR a aj mimo SR, ktore bezia na tejto DB,
  • zaujimave info o projektoch, ktore povedia nieco o velkosti projektu, o zatazi, ktoru uvedena DB tam musi zvladat a pod.,
  • benchmarky tejto DB voci ostatnym, najma ORACLE, nakolko toto sa v SR pomerne dobre predava,
  • pozitiva a negativa z oblasti ako je adminnistracia,
  • uzitcne ficury, ktore ma iba tato DB,
  • ficury, ktore ma tato DB lepsie ako ine konkurencne produkty,
  • hocico co vas napadne a je vhodne zdielania…
1 Like

K veľkosti a skalovatelnosti postgresql mám toto. https://www.pgcon.org/2016/schedule/track/DBA/923.en.html

Oracle má paralelné queries, postgresql začína od 9.6 ale rád by som videl kde toto je problém pri štátnom projekte. Okrem BI podľa mňa bullshit.

Podpora je isto menšia. Najmä kvôli cenovke.

PS. Všetky dáta v ekosyateme čiže niekoľko registrov sú v pohodicke v jednej db. Postgresql.

ok, ideme do startupu na support? :slight_smile:

1 Like

A co sa poctu instalacii tyka… toto treba brat s rezervou lebo tipnem, ze su to vacsinou male vecicky.

What we’ve observed from running the largest fleet of Postgres in the world (over 750k databases) and heavily engaging with the Postgres community
https://blog.heroku.com/connection_limit_guidance

Pripadne z Quory vyberam

Stats from Skype deployment
Over 100 database servers and 200 databases
Largest table has several billions of records.
Over 10000 transactions per second.
Databases are used mainly for web store, billing and other centrally provided services.
All accessed through stored procedures.

Here at Altos Research, we use Postgres as our primary storage service for our real estate market data. Our repository of approximately 5 years of US housing data and derived statistics currently occupies about 1.8T of disk.

I would think one of the biggest installation of PostgreSQL (besides Skype, of course) is probably Caixa Bank in Brazil. One “Caixa” employee told me off the records they serve around 190 millions of Brazilian people with a system which backend is PostgreSQL.

https://www.quora.com/What-is-the-largest-production-deployment-of-PostgreSQL-for-online-use

Viac sa mi hladat nechce.

Z mojej skusenosti ked niekto zacne mavat takymito argumentami, tak sa ho treba ako prve spytat, ze aky tam cakaju load a kolko tam bude dat a co s tym chcu akoze robit co Oracle ma a hocico ine nie.

2 Likes

Instagram bezi vela veci v Postgrese, ale nieco ako uceleny clanok na
ich blogu o vyhodach tam budete hladat tazko, vacsinou je to o tom ako
skaluju pri poctoch uzivateloch ktore su hodne nad ramec poctu
pouzivatelov statnych informacnych systemoch v tejto krajine. Napriklad:

Co sa tyka success stories v nasom regione, pani z CSPUG by mohli pomoct:

http://cspug.cz/

namatkovo

Petr Jelinek zo 2ndQuadrant by mohol tiez pomoct, pravdepodobne ale bude
v CSPUG komunite.

EnterpriseDB ma layer ktory by mal byt kompatibilny.
http://www.enterprisedb.com/solutions/oracle-compatibility-technology a
teda potencionalna migracia business logiky napisanej v PL/SQL by nemala
znamenat prepis celej aplikacie, alebo by nemala trvat tolko co panom z
Yandexu.

r.

1 Like

Backend data.gov.sk je CKAN + PostgreSQL.

State media company Rossiya Segodnya and Moscow’s regional government switched from Oracle database systems to open-code PostgreSQL software supported by local programmers, according to Digital Russia.

niekedy stačí na open source trošku nacionalizmu, neskúsime to po tej línii?

2 Likes

Registratura na ministerstve kultury (mksr), zarucena konverzia na mksr, elektronicka podatelna a dlhodobe doveryhodne ulozisko na mksr bezia na postgresql. A navyse uprednostnuju open source.

3 Likes

vies mi dat aj info, ze ako dlho to tam takto bezi, kolko podani napr. tyzdenne vybavia alebo nejake ine zaujime ukazovatele vykonnosti, pouzivanosti.

dik

Vedel by som to zistit, ale musem sa opytat na mk ci to mozem zverejnit.
zabudol som napisat, ze to plati aj pre vsetky podriadene organizacie mksr (odhadom 30), ako napriklad muzea atd
Je tam cca 1500 pouzivatelov, 15 databaz a 4 db servery (kvoli HA) sa viac menej nudia.

3 Likes

…mate niekto tipy a realne skusenosti s firmami, ktore v SVK alebo CZ robia plateny support pre PostgreSQL?..